Best Next-Gen Retinoids (For Faster Results) If you want something faster than retinol but gentler than prescription-strength treatments, look for **Retinal (Retinaldehyde)** or **Granactive Retinoid**. * **The Ordinary Retinal 0.2% Emulsion** * * **Why it’s great:** Retinal only requires *one* conversion step by the skin to become active retinoic acid (whereas retinol requires two). This delivers much faster results on fine lines and acne. * **Minimalist 2% Granactive Retinoid Cream** * * **Why it’s great:** Granactive retinoid is a next-generation complex that gives all the anti-aging benefits of standard vitamin A derivatives but causes next to zero redness or peeling. --- ### 💡 The Golden Rules for Using Retinol in India: 1. **Start Slow:** Use it only **2 to 3 nights a week** to begin with, then gradually build up to every other night. 2. **The Sandwich Method:** If your skin is dry, apply a layer of moisturizer, let it dry, apply your retinol, and follow up with another layer of moisturizer. 3. **Never Skip Sunscreen:** Retinol makes your skin highly sensitive to the Indian sun. Applying a broad-spectrum SPF 50 the next morning is non-negotiable. By the way, to unlock the full functionality of all Apps, enable.

Retinol Buying Guide | Skin Concern | Recommended Active Level | Top Pick Ingredient Combination | |---|---|---| | **Acne Marks & Pores** | Low-to-Medium (Encapsulated) | Retinol + Ceramides + Niacinamide | | **Fine Lines & Wrinkles** | Medium (0.3% to 0.5%) | Pure Retinol + Antioxidants (Q10/Peptides) | | **Sensitive/Dry Skin** | Very Low (0.1% to 0.2% Cream) | Retinol + Squalane or Hyaluronic Acid | Crucial Retinol Rules 1. **The 1-2-3 Rule**: If you are new, apply it once a week for the first week, twice a week for the second week, and three times a week from the third week onwards to avoid irritation. 2. **PM Only**: Only use retinol during your nighttime routine as sunlight degrades the active ingredient. 3. **Sunscreen is Non-Negotiable**: Retinol increases skin sensitivity to UV rays; always apply a broad-spectrum SPF 30 or higher the next morning. 4. **Pregnancy Caution**: Retinol is not safe to use during pregnancy or lactation.
